> A bug in GCC causes shared libraries linked with -ffast-math to disable > denormal arithmetic. This breaks Java's floating-point semantics. > > The bug is https://gcc.gnu.org/bugzilla/show_bug.cgi?id=55522 > > One solution is to save and restore the floating-point control word around > System.loadLibrary(). This isn't perfect, because some shared library might > load another shared library at runtime, but it's a lot better than what we do > now. > > However, this fix is not complete. `dlopen()` is called from many places in > the JDK. I guess the best thing to do is find and wrap them all. I'd like to > hear people's opinions.
